How important is plastic to the economy?
The US plastics industry accounted for an estimated $432 billion in shipments and more than one million jobs in 2019, according to the "2020 Size & Impact Report" from the Plastics Industry Association. Plastics are critical to the US economy.

What is polyurethane used for?
Polyurethanes, an entire family of related polymers, are widely used in foam insulation for homes and appliances, as well as in architectural coatings. … the automotive sector uses increasing amounts of thermoplastics, primarily to reduce weight and hence achieve greater fuel efficiency standards.

How many people work in the plastics industry in California?
At the state level, California’s plastics industry workforce is the largest, with an estimated 79,700 workers in 2019.
Which state has the highest concentration of plastics workers?
Indiana and Michigan have the highest concentration of plastics industry workers, each with an estimated 16 plastics employees for every 1,000 non-farm workers. Graphic courtesy Plastics Industry Association.

What is the role of plastic in construction?
Plastics play a significant role in the building and construction industry as well. In fact, the industry is the second largest consumer of plastic, followed only by the packaging industry. In the construction industry, plastics are used for items such as pipes and valves.

Why was plastic used in aerospace?
During the war, plastic slowly started to be used as a substitute for rubber in items such as fliers' boots and fuel-tank linings. Eventually, it became the preferred material for these applications. Plastic was then used with airborne radar systems and viewed as a significant advancement in this technology because it allowed waves to pass through with minimal loss.

Does China still buy plastic?
Government legislation is forcing the packaging industry to change and adapt too. Last year, China announced it would no longer buy the world's discarded plastics. Up until relatively recently, China was importing 45% of the world's plastic waste imports 2 so the move created major disruption for the recycling industry.
